11 Years' Jail For Man Who Raped Girlfriend's Daughter

The Straits Times

|

February 14, 2025

Teen Was 13 When First Abused; She Became Withdrawn And Dropped Out Of School

- Selina Lum

A 32-year-old man who sexually abused his then girlfriend's teenage daughter for more than a year was sentenced to 11 years' jail and eight strokes of the cane on Feb 13.

He pleaded guilty to a charge of sexual assault by penetration. Five other charges, including two counts of rape, were taken into consideration.

Prosecutors told the High Court that because of the man's actions, the victim—who was 13 to 14 years old at the time of the offences—suffered in school.

Once a helpful and participative student with leadership qualities, she became withdrawn and had poor attendance, eventually dropping out of school when she was 16 due to her inability to focus.

In sentencing the man, Justice Dedar Singh Gill took into account the harm caused to the victim and his abuse of his position of trust.
